How to say navy in Korean
Korean: 해군[ hae-gun ]

Meaning
Navy means the military force that works at sea. In Korean, 해군 means the ships and people who protect a country on the ocean. You use this word when talking about the military, the sea, or a job in the armed forces.
Example sentences
삼촌은 해군에서 일해요.
My uncle works in the navy.
해변에서 해군 배를 봤어요.
I saw a navy ship at the beach.
네 동생은 해군에 지원하고 있어요.
My brother is applying to join the navy.
해군 박물관에서 전시물을 봤어요.
I saw exhibits at a navy museum.
